List of the functions and which equipment uses them according to what we already know:

Gloves
Protection, (cross arms, overlapping wrists to form a shield in front of you)
Remote viewing, (close eyes, look through the eyes on the palms of the glove. only works with your own gloves. Gloves do not need to be worn for it to work)
gloves also allow us to hold magical objects without being affected, or to push magic out of objects.

Robes
storage, (sleeves are hammerspace)
environmental regulation, (also works with gloves)

Needles
siphoning of magical power,
fusion of materials, (tap with pointy end, tap second material with handle end.)
perception of the unseen, (look through the eye of the needle for this)
linking of sound, vision, and physical person, (I am unclear on this one. Our needle links might be this. but what does linking physical person mean?)

?
Teleportation, (I have been unable to figure out how this works. Feel free to ask about it) (Probably talking about the conduit, actually)
transpositional movement, (pulling thread of needle link?)
servitude,
telekinesis,
shape shifting.
